Ok what Im looking for is what you would shoot for in stats when creating suits for mage pvm template and say a fighter/archer bushido pvm template.

So what resists would be considered optimal, I understand that you want higher fire resist due to say a curse but what other resists would you take past the 70 max (any difference between the mage/fighter considerations)

Is there any artifact that you would try to incorporate into a suit? Say something with SDI for a mage/ mace-shield glasses for a fighter

Not worried about Talismans or aprons etc I will figure that requirement after my play style just looking for the end resist-bonus's++ that you would look for in a finished crafted suit. Figure if im going to spend the time to use that crafting artifact to craft some suit pieces I don't wont to realize I missed something from suit

Final resist values really depend on the spells you're going to be using and the creatures you're going to be engaging. If your goal is to max resists in each category, just start at the max and add enough points to cover any negative spell effects. As a mage/archer you may not need to max everything. I fact, I would imagine you could sacrifice quite a bit of physical resist for some other property (e.g. DCI) ... that is if you are planning to avoid taking physical damage.

You've really asked 3 vastly different questions here: mage, melee, and archer suits are going to be, aside from shooting for good resists, and LMC, quite different across the board.

If you're looking for advice on how to build a suit for a melee fighter, there are some VERY nicely written guides over in the Warrior forum, from ones that talk about where to begin as your just starting out, all the way up to discussions on how to go about a 210 stamina. There are discussions on material: metal vs wood vs studded leather, to instructions on what to reforge and how.

I'd go ahead and read all those, and then ask more pointed questions, perhaps after deciding on what kind of template you want to run too. Interestingly though, I think what you'll find is, for melee chars: its all in the weapon(s).
